Valerie Solanas: The Defiant Life of the Woman Who Wrote SCUM (and Shot Andy Warhol)

by Breanne Fahs

Presents the life and philosophies of Valerie Solanas, a feminist extremist who outlined in her "SCUM Manifesto" her vision for a radical gender dystopia and who shot Andy Warhol in 1968.
